Pressured In Early Trade
NZD
NZD/USD prints at $0.6313, ~0.3% in trading this morning.
- A bid in USD/JPY, as Nikkei reports that the Japanese Govt approached Amamiya the BoJ Deputy Governor about succeeding Kuroda as the head of the central bank, has spilled over into broader USD strength.
- NZD/USD has been pressured this morning in thin liquidity, support has come in ahead of $0.63.
- On Friday NZD/USD was offered in the wake of stronger than expected NFP print in the US. The pair broke out of recent ranges, clearing resistance at its 20-day EMA and closing below its 50-day EMA.
- Bears next target the 200-Day EMA at $0.6292. Bulls first target 50-day EMA at $0.6339.
- Liquidity will be impacted today as domestic markets are closed due to the Waitangi Day holiday.
